Discovering How Breakthrough CAD Milling Innovations and Industry Dynamics Are Redefining Precision Manufacturing and Competitive Edge in Modern Production

The advent of computer numerical control milling systems has ushered in a new era of precision manufacturing, transforming the way products are designed and produced. Advances in internet connectivity, machine learning, and real-time monitoring have converged to reshape traditional milling workflows, enabling engineers to achieve tighter tolerances, faster turnaround times, and unprecedented levels of customization. This convergence has not only elevated the performance of milling operations but also expanded their application scope across sectors ranging from aerospace to medical devices.

Transitioning from manual to automated setups, organizations are capitalizing on software-driven toolpath optimization and adaptive control algorithms to improve material removal rates and reduce scrap. As digital twins and cloud-based collaboration become standard practice, cross-functional teams can iterate designs more efficiently and validate machining processes virtually before committing to physical prototypes. Consequently, time to market has shortened, enabling companies to respond more swiftly to consumer demands and regulatory changes.

Looking ahead, the integration of additive and subtractive processes promises to further enhance CAD milling capabilities by enabling hybrid manufacturing paths. In tandem with advances in tool materials and sensor technologies, these developments are poised to drive the next wave of innovation. Against this backdrop, decision-makers must align strategic investments with emerging trends to secure a sustainable competitive edge.

How Converging Technological Advancements and Market Forces Are Transforming CAD Milling Workflows to Unlock New Levels of Efficiency Quality and Customization

Technological innovation has been the primary catalyst reshaping the CAD milling landscape, as machine builders introduce more intuitive interfaces and advanced control software. Conversational programming has democratized access to sophisticated toolpath generation, allowing operators with varying skill levels to leverage complex machining strategies without extensive training. Meanwhile, software-based controls integrate seamlessly with enterprise resource planning systems, providing end-to-end visibility into production schedules and resource utilization.

Simultaneously, the demand for high-axis machines has spurred growth in 4-axis and 5-axis configurations, unlocking complex geometries and reducing the need for manual re-fixturing. Prototyping applications have benefited from rapid tool changes and modular setups, accelerating product development cycles. In mass production environments, robust 3-axis systems equipped with automated material handling have achieved consistent throughput, fulfilling the needs of job shops and large-scale manufacturers alike.

As industries embrace digital transformation, connectivity enhancements such as OPC UA and MTConnect protocols facilitate real-time data exchange among machines, systems, and analytics platforms. This interoperability drives predictive maintenance strategies and enables continuous improvement through data-driven insights. Consequently, competitors that adopt these interconnected frameworks position themselves to exploit operational efficiencies, mitigate downtime, and maintain superior quality standards.

Evaluating the Broad Economic and Operational Consequences of 2025 United States Tariffs on CAD Milling Equipment Supply Chains and Cost Structures

The implementation of new tariff structures in 2025 has introduced significant cost considerations for companies importing milling components and turnkey systems. Higher levies on critical subassemblies, such as precision spindles and linear guides, have led manufacturers to re-evaluate global sourcing strategies and production footprints. In response, some suppliers have transitioned to dual-sourcing models or relocated key operations closer to end markets to mitigate tariff-driven expenses and reduce lead times.

Moreover, the ripple effects of these tariffs extend to downstream industries that rely on CNC milling, including aerospace, medical devices, and electronics. Production cost increases have prompted several end users to explore local machining partnerships or invest in in-house milling capabilities to retain control over critical processes. These strategic shifts underscore the need for agility in supply chain design, as companies seek to balance cost, quality, and delivery performance.

Navigating this tariff environment demands a nuanced understanding of trade agreements and classification rules. Organizations have begun leveraging tariff engineering solutions and alternative free trade zone setups to minimize duties. As global trade dynamics continue to evolve, stakeholders must monitor policy developments closely and adapt procurement policies in order to safeguard margins and maintain competitive pricing structures.

Illuminating Critical Market Segmentation Insights Based on Control Types Axis Configurations Applications Machine Sizes and End User Industry Requirements

A nuanced understanding of control type segmentation reveals that computer numerical control platforms have become the default choice for high-precision applications, with a significant portion of installations leveraging conversational interfaces for ease of programming. Software-based control systems have gained traction in environments demanding advanced simulation and remote management. Manual systems, while still present in entry-level settings, are dwindling as organizations pursue greater automation and repeatability.

Axis configuration choices play a pivotal role in balancing flexibility and cost. Three-axis mills remain integral to basic milling operations, yet the demand for four-axis machines has risen in shops specializing in complex contouring. Meanwhile, five-axis machining centers have unlocked multi-faceted component fabrication, enabling intricate part geometries and reducing cycle times through simultaneous multi-axis movement.

The application-based segmentation underscores the importance of mold making in both metal and plastic sectors, where precision surface finishes and tight dimensional tolerances are paramount. Production environments differentiate between job shop agility and mass production consistency, whereas prototyping facilities increasingly rely on rapid prototyping to iterate design concepts swiftly. These distinctions inform equipment selection and process workflows across diverse manufacturing settings.

Considering machine size, large-format bridge and gantry solutions address the needs of heavy structural milling, while medium floorstanding units serve general-purpose machining centers. Compact benchtop and desktop variants cater to small-scale workshops and educational environments, providing an accessible entry point to digital milling capabilities.

End user industry segmentation highlights the aerospace sector’s split between commercial and defense program requirements, each demanding rigorous certification and traceability. The automotive landscape differentiates between original equipment manufacturers’ integrated supply chains and the dynamic aftermarket segment. Consumer and industrial electronics sectors prioritize miniaturization and precision, while medical applications range from diagnostic equipment housings to implantable device structures, each governed by strict regulatory standards.

Unraveling Diverse Regional Dynamics Shaping CAD Milling Adoption Trends and Opportunities Across the Americas Europe Middle East Africa and Asia-Pacific Markets

In the Americas, the proximity to major aerospace and automotive manufacturing hubs has fueled robust demand for advanced milling solutions, particularly in regions housing key original equipment manufacturers. Cross-border trade between Canada, the United States, and Mexico benefits from integrated supply chain frameworks, although recent tariff shifts have introduced complexity in procurement strategies. In the medical device subsector, aggressive innovation cycles in the United States and Mexico’s burgeoning production capabilities continue to drive investments in mid-tier and high-precision milling equipment.

Europe, the Middle East, and Africa present a tapestry of market drivers, from Germany’s mature automotive clusters to the rapidly expanding electronics manufacturing base in Eastern Europe. Regulatory standards across EMEA maintain high thresholds for quality and documentation, propelling machine tool suppliers to offer comprehensive post-sales services and certification support. In the Middle East, infrastructure development and national manufacturing initiatives have stimulated interest in flexible milling platforms that can accommodate diverse project requirements.

Across Asia-Pacific, robust industrialization efforts in China and Southeast Asia have catalyzed strong uptake of both entry-level and high-end CNC systems. Japanese and South Korean manufacturers continue to lead in precision and reliability, while India’s emerging ecosystem emphasizes cost-effectiveness and local service networks. These regional dynamics underscore the importance of tailored market approaches, as suppliers optimize product portfolios and channel strategies to address varied economic landscapes and regulatory frameworks.

Profiling Leading CAD Milling Equipment Providers Highlighting Competitive Strategies Innovations Collaborations and Market Positioning in a Rapidly Evolving Industry

Leading equipment providers have sharpened their competitive edge by focusing on modular machine architectures that accommodate future upgrades, ensuring long-term value for end users. Strategic partnerships with software developers have enabled several companies to integrate artificial intelligence-driven toolpath optimization features, positioning their solutions at the forefront of smart manufacturing initiatives. In addition, investments in service infrastructure have become a cornerstone of differentiation, as rapid response times and remote diagnostics capabilities directly influence customer satisfaction and equipment uptime.

Collaborations between machine builders and material science firms have resulted in innovative tooling solutions designed to maximize spindle performance and extend cutter life across a diverse range of alloys and composites. These alliances underscore the importance of an ecosystem approach to product development, ensuring that hardware and consumables evolve in tandem to meet emerging manufacturing requirements. Furthermore, several market leaders have pursued geographic expansion through acquisitions, establishing local assembly operations and customer support centers to reduce lead times and enhance aftersales engagement.

As competition intensifies, discrete manufacturers and machine tool conglomerates alike are increasingly focusing on sustainability credentials, offering low-emission drive systems and energy recovery options. This holistic approach to product design and service delivery not only meets growing regulatory pressures but also resonates with customers seeking to improve their environmental footprint and operational efficiency concurrently.
